Question: How much of my time (and my apprentice's time) will this actually take?
Answer: We designed this for time-poor founders. Your apprentice spends roughly 3–5 hours per week on structured learning and "Business Impact Tasks." As the Founder/Sponsor, your commitment is minimal: a 15-minute monthly alignment check to ensure their projects are solving your actual problems. We don't add to your plate; we use the program to clear it.

Question: How soon will I see a tangible result in my business?
Answer: You should see the first "win" in Phase 1 (Modules 1-3). The very first tasks require the apprentice to map your value chain and identify financial efficiency leaks. Unlike academic courses, we don't wait for "graduation" to provide value. If they aren't bringing you a new insight or a solved problem by Month 3, we aren't doing our job.
